Legal Basis for Processing

We process your personal data based on the following legal grounds:

  • Consent: When you have given explicit consent for specific purposes
  • Contract: When processing is necessary to fulfil our contractual obligations
  • Legitimate Interest: When we have a legitimate business interest
  • Legal Obligation: When required by law

Your GDPR Rights

Under GDPR, you have the following rights:

  • Right to Access: Request copies of your personal data
  • Right to Rectification: Request correction of inaccurate data
  • Right to Erasure: Request deletion of your personal data
  • Right to Restrict Processing: Request limitation of data processing
  • Right to Data Portability: Receive your data in a portable format
  • Right to Object: Object to certain types of processing
  • Rights Related to Automated Decision-Making: Not be subject to automated decisions
